Bright Engrams are not meant to be a direct source of Exotics or Exotic Engrams. Bright Engrams usually reward ancient old items from bygone era's of the past. You'd be lucky to get some weird Ship from 7 years ago or perhaps a Ghost like one response claimed that's exotic. But never Armor or Weapons that I know of.

Farming higher level activities and ritual activities and completing weekly challenges that reset every Tuesday have a greater chance to reward Exotic Engrams which you can then take the risk and decipher them instantly at the Tower with Rahool and hope to get a decent piece of exotic armor you're after; or you can choose what item you want out of it for a cost, again with Rahool by going into the boxes where the items available for your class will show and what the cost is in addition to the Exotic Engram. The latter guarantees a better roll of points per perk that, at the end of the day, make you strongest with the highest roll. My highest level item is a pair of Orpheus Rigs for the Hunter that totals out to 90, it's one I paid a hefty cost for in materials in exchange for the perfect roll and I love it and I would do it again.

Every so often, just playing in general in the open world will drop an Exotic Engram as well. Getting them obviously is not a challenge but if you're after something specific, then a little homework and budgeting of materials will pay off.
